Mumbai, Dec. 20 -- During the announcement of India's squad for the ICC T20 World Cup 2026 and the T20I series against New Zealand at home, the Indian chief selector Ajit Agarkar spoke on Shubman Gill's omission from the side despite being the vice-captain the format since Asia Cup, saying that the team is looking at combinations at the moment with two top-order wicketkeeping options and continuity by handing back the VC duties to Axar Patel, who was playing this role while Gill had a hectic run in the red-ball and ODI sides from last year's home Test series against Bangladesh to ICC Champions Trophy this year.
